What’s a Gravatar?

You know those little images that appear by the side of people’s comments on WordPress posts? Those are Gravatars.

Now, it isn’t necessary to have a Gravatar. You’ll even be assigned a default image to your posts if you haven’t set one up. But having your own picture makes your posts much more identifiable and helps towards giving you the impression of professionalism and authority.
